Impact of Mulberry Leaf on Type 2 Diabetes
Completed · Phase 2/Phase 3 · Has a placebo group
Conditions studied: Type 2 Diabetes
In brief
The purpose of this study is to evaluate whether mulberry leaf extract will help control blood sugar in patients with type 2 diabetes. We also want to look at the safety of mulberry leaf extract in these patients.

Who can join
Age: 18 and older. Sex: any. Healthy volunteers: not accepted.
You may qualify if…
- Type 2 diabetes
- No diabetes medication adjustments for at least 2 months
- Stable hemoglobin A1C [Between 7.0% to 8.0% (inclusive) and not varying by more than 10% since prior visit; If no A1C exists prior to the current visit and no medication adjustments are made, the current A1C may used as the baseline]
You may not qualify if…
- On insulin
- History of overt cardiovascular disease
- History of missed appointments or non-compliance with medications
- History of hepatic or renal insufficiency
- History of hemoglobinopathies
- Women of reproductive potential not on oral contraceptives
- Pregnant/nursing women.
